What To Look For In A Camping Chair Made for Bad Backs

Traditional camp chairs are uncomfortable to sit in – even for short periods of time. The poor back posture caused by the lack of lumbar support in the chair design causes discomfort and often pain.

If you love sitting around the campfire, then you know how important a comfortable camping chair is, especially if you have a bad back.

While there are plenty of brands and styles on the market to choose from, most don’t offer enough back support for your back.

Here are a few things to consider before deciding on a camping chair:

Does The Chair Have Lumbar Support

what is lumbar support

The most important feature to look for when deciding on a chair for your bad back is that it has lumbar support!

What is lumbar support?

Lumbar support refers to the five vertebrae in the spine that are located between the diaphragm and the sacrum. This area is referred to as the lumbar region.

Chairs that claim to have “lumbar support”, will have extra support, specifically designed to help keep your spine properly aligned in its natural position.

By keeping your spine properly aligned, your muscles won’t have to work as hard in order to support your back, which should help to relieve, if not eliminate your back pain.

Is The Frame Strong and Fabric Strong

Frame

Having a camping chair with lumbar support means nothing if it’s made from poor quality materials.

First, you want to make sure that the frame is made of a strong material such as steel. And not just any steel frame will do! It needs to be thick. I recommend something over 20mm.

Something else to look for is a frame that is powder coated. This not only looks better, but it will give your chair better protection against the elements.

Fabric 

The fabric material is something else to consider! You don’t want a chair with a low-quality fabric for its seat and back support. Over time a poor quality material will stretch and begin to deteriorate, which in turn can make for a very uncomfortable chair.

I recommend looking for a chair that has a heavy duty polyester fabric with at least a 400D (denier) fabric rating!

In case you don’t know, the denier rating is a measurement that determines how strong a fabric is. The higher the number, the stronger the fabric. All of the chairs on our list have a denier rating of 600, making super durable and waterproof.

Is The Chair Big Enough

I don’t care how much back support a chair has, if it’s too small for you, it’s not going to do you or your back much good. On the flip side, if the chair is too big, you could be doing just as much harm to your back as with a small chair.

Make sure to choose a chair that matches your body size. This includes your height as well as your weight. The last thing you want is for your chair to collapse on you while enjoying a hot cocoa around the campfire!
